The City Commission and City Manager Jim Scholl last night commended retiring Pearline Lewis for her 30 years of service to the City.

For the past 13 years, Mrs. Lewis has served as the City’s Worker’s Compensation Specialist. She started with the City in the finance department in 1986, and has worked in human resources as well.

“Mrs. Lewis has always served the public in a professional and courteous manner,” said Scholl. “She has been open to innovative ideas, always worked as a team player, always kept the best interest of our employees at the forefront of her daily practices and still managed to find a balance and fairmindedness amidst the delicate nature of her position.”
